Wednesday, May 19, 2010

Science Fiction Double Feature--Richard O'Brien


Rip Jagger said...

That was a hoot!

Thanks for posting it. I really enjoyed back in the VHS era collecting up the movies referenced in this song.

Rip Off

Black Bat Inc. said...

Love it!!! especially because Richard is sitting on giant lips!! HA!